Housemarque puts Stormdivers on hold to focus on biggest project yet

Housemarque’s CEO Ilari Kuittinen has penned an open letter celebrating 25 years of the studio’s existence. The developer has been making game’s since the mid 90’s but really shot into the spotlight with Resogun. Since then it has released Matterfall and then announced the battle royale title Stormbreakers as well as a yet unrevealed AAA title for an undisclosed publisher. Stormbreakers took a bit of a hit after the battle royale genre got even more crowded, and now Housemarque’s Ilari has confirmed that the game has been put on a hiatus.

The reason for this hiatus is because now every member of the 80 person studio is working on the unannounced triple-A project which is being billed as Housemarque’s biggest game to date. In the open letter Illari wrote:

Looking back on where we started and where the games industry is today is quite astonishing as back then we could only dream of living in such a digital age that players could instantly download games directly to their device(s), and now there are so many amazing, critically acclaimed games coming out that it’s hard to keep up with the influx of launches, much less play them all. However, our continuing goal remains in maintaining our standards and develop unique, world-class games for our fans while still providing a great workplace that supports our team in developing professionally as well as living full personal lives. We also recognize that this work is never-ending, as demands for creating top-quality games are getting ever higher and the bar is raised every year. 

So now we are focused on delivering our most ambitious and biggest game to date, putting every other project on hold, including the development of Stormdivers. It is great that the whole company can come together to deliver this game, which will define the next evolution of Housemarque. We are very humbled to have amazing support from our partner over the course of the past few years, and this support has continuously grown on a monthly basis. 

What does this mean for Stormdivers then? Well, it hasn’t been outright cancelled but the game’s priority has obviously shifted downwards in light on this other project Housemarque is working on. There are no clues as to what this project could be or who the unnamed publisher is, or when we can expect more news. What is likely is that this new project will appear on the next generation of consoles. It could be a cross-generational title for all we know. Housemarque will share more in the coming months.
